Your role will be both hands-on and problem-solving-oriented, as you diagnose and resolve technical issues, ensuring our equipment operates at peak efficiency. You’ll also be the guardian of preventative maintenance, conducting essential check-ups that keep our fleet running smoothly.
Traveling to various customer locations, you’ll bring your expertise to service Linde forklifts and other state-of-the-art material handling equipment, forging strong relationships, and delivering exceptional support. Prepare to be on the move, tackling challenges head-on and becoming an integral part of our customers’ operation.
We are interested in candidates with experience as vehicle technicians or mechanical engineers, particularly those who have worked as forklift technicians, plant fitters, plant technicians, or vehicle technicians.
Experience with plant equipment, powered access equipment, agricultural machinery, motor vehicles, or industrial cleaners is highly desirable, but not sure if you have what we want, why not talk to us.
Ideally you will have an NVQ level 3 (or equivalent) qualification, although this is not essential.
We use the latest technology to keep accurate records and place orders, therefore being comfortable using IT equipment is essential.
You will need to hold a full UK driving license.
As a Linde engineer you will need to be comfortable working autonomously and within a team.
